## Runbook: Pulsewire websocket reconnect loop

If clients get stuck in a reconnect storm after a gateway restart, don't panic — it's the known backoff bug in Pulsewire 2.3. Drain the affected gateway, bump the backoff cap, and redeploy. Before touching anything, confirm the node is running with these configuration values.

settings of tagef-bawif:
DRUIX_HOST=druix.zemvarlabs.internal
DRUIX_PORT=8000

The retention sweeper in Hollowgate runs nightly and hard-deletes records past their policy window, so treat every change here with care: there is no undelete. Policies are defined per data class, and the sweeper refuses to run if any class lacks an explicit rule — this is deliberate, not a bug. Dry-run mode logs candidates without deleting; always dry-run after policy edits and compare counts against the previous week. Policy definitions, dry-run reports, and the escalation procedure are maintained on the page below.

wiki page, tahaf-tajog: https://jira.ordindyn.corp/pipeline

## Who to ping about GiftNote

Welcome aboard! GiftNote is our donation-receipt mailer for the Larchfield Fund. Template tweaks go to the comms folks; delivery failures and bounce weirdness go to the platform crew. Don't push template changes on Fridays — receipts batch over the weekend. For anything GiftNote-related, start with the address below.

billing contact of kaweg-tajeg = drudor.lamion.oliath@torvalabs.test

**Checklist: template rendering perf gate (Coldmire v9 cut)**

Before promoting, run the render benchmark against the Hollowfen template set. Budget: p95 under 40ms per page, no regression beyond 5% from the prior tag. If the partial-cache warmup skews the first pass, discard it and rerun. Failures block the cut — page the Brindlewick perf rotation, don't waive it yourself. Attach the benchmark report to the release doc. Record the numbers alongside the build token below.

pipeline stamp: htk4_a42b